WhT is there relationship between the lines having the equations y=4x+2 and y=1/4x?

Is it because they are neither parallel nor perpendicular?

1 answer

parallel means they have the same gradient. 4 does not equal 1/4, so it isn't parallel.

perpendicular means the two gradients multiplied must equal -1. 4*1/4=1 so it isn't perpendicular.

these two points have a point of intersection, meaning the lines touch each other at a point.
u can find this out by making them equal to each other. 4x+2=1/4x to find the x point. then sub the x point, to find the y point.
